Whether your boiler breaks down in the middle of winter or your air conditioning struggles through a Belgian summer, finding a reliable heating and cooling specialist in Oisquercq and the surrounding Tubize area is a practical priority for homeowners and businesses alike. Local HVAC work typically covers installation, maintenance, and repair of heating systems, ventilation units, and climate control equipment — tasks that require both technical skill and knowledge of current energy regulations. When comparing professionals, look for VAT numbers verified through the VIES system, transparent hourly rates in the €55–€95 range, and the availability of free, no-obligation quotes. For this type of installation: check the professional's approvals and certifications (RGIE compliance, Cerga, RESCert as applicable) and require the conformity certificate at completion — you will need it when selling or for your insurer.
